news 2026/4/18 8:04:55

3招搞定乐谱数字化:从扫描到编辑的极简方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
3招搞定乐谱数字化:从扫描到编辑的极简方案

3招搞定乐谱数字化:从扫描到编辑的极简方案

【免费下载链接】audiverisaudiveris - 一个开源的光学音乐识别(OMR)应用程序,用于将乐谱图像转录为其符号对应物,支持多种数字处理方式。项目地址: https://gitcode.com/gh_mirrors/au/audiveris

Audiveris是一款强大的开源光学音乐识别(OMR)工具,能将纸质乐谱图像精准转换为可编辑的数字格式。无论是音乐爱好者整理个人收藏,还是专业音乐人需要快速数字化乐谱,这款工具都能提供高效解决方案,让乐谱数字化不再困难。

图像采集规范:打造高质量识别基础

常见误区:忽视图像质量对识别结果的影响

很多用户直接使用手机随意拍摄乐谱,导致图像模糊、光线不均或存在阴影,严重影响后续识别精度。实际上,高质量的输入图像是获得精准识别结果的基础。

解决步骤:专业级图像采集四步法

  1. 设备选择:优先使用扫描仪(推荐300DPI分辨率),若使用相机拍摄需确保镜头与乐谱平面保持平行
  2. 环境设置:在均匀白光下拍摄,避免闪光灯造成反光,去除乐谱上的杂物
  3. 拍摄技巧:保持乐谱平整,充满画面且边缘清晰可见,避免倾斜和透视变形
  4. 格式选择:保存为PNG或TIFF格式,避免JPEG压缩导致的细节损失

乐谱识别中的图像转换流程,展示从原始图像到二值化处理的完整过程,乐谱识别的基础步骤

💡实用提示:对于老旧乐谱,可先使用图像处理软件修复折痕和污渍,再进行扫描。扫描时选择"黑白模式"而非"灰度模式",能有效减少干扰信息。

参数配置矩阵:针对不同乐谱类型的优化方案

常见误区:盲目使用默认参数处理所有乐谱

很多新手直接使用默认参数处理所有类型的乐谱,导致吉他谱、打击乐谱等特殊类型乐谱识别效果不佳。实际上,不同类型的乐谱需要针对性的参数配置。

解决步骤:参数配置三步优化法

  1. 基础参数设置:在"Book Parameters"界面配置图像缩放比例和线间距
  2. 乐谱类型选择:根据乐谱特点选择对应的识别模板(古典乐谱/现代乐谱/吉他谱)
  3. 高级参数调校:调整音符识别灵敏度和符号检测阈值

Audiveris的书籍参数配置界面,展示如何设置乐谱识别的各项参数,乐谱识别的核心配置环节

不同场景参数组合方案对比

乐谱类型二值化阈值线间距(mm)符号识别灵敏度推荐设置
古典乐谱0.6-0.75.0-6.5默认模板
现代简谱0.5-0.64.0-5.0简化符号集
吉他六线谱0.7-0.83.5-4.5中高吉他专用模板
打击乐谱0.65-0.755.5-7.0打击乐符号集

💡实用提示:对于复杂乐谱,可先使用"预览"功能测试不同参数组合的效果,再应用到整个项目。保存优质参数组合作为自定义模板,方便后续同类乐谱处理。

错误修正技巧:提升识别结果质量的关键步骤

常见误区:完全依赖自动识别,忽视人工修正

许多用户期望一次识别就能获得完美结果,忽视了必要的人工修正环节。实际上,即使最先进的OMR工具也需要人工干预来处理复杂情况。

解决步骤:高效错误修正四步法

  1. 整体检查:使用"浏览模式"快速检查整个乐谱的识别情况,标记明显错误区域
  2. 符号修正:重点检查音符时值、休止符和变音符号的识别准确性
  3. 节奏调整:修正节拍划分和连音线错误,确保音乐节奏正确
  4. 文本校对:检查乐谱中的文字信息(如速度标记、表情记号)是否准确识别

Audiveris的OMR引擎处理步骤流程图,展示从图像加载到最终输出的完整工作流程,乐谱识别的技术原理

多页乐谱批量处理技巧

  1. 使用"Book"功能创建多页项目,统一管理整本乐谱
  2. 设置"页面链接"功能,确保跨页乐句的正确连接
  3. 利用"复制参数"功能将优化后的参数应用到所有页面
  4. 采用"分段处理"策略,对复杂页面单独调整参数

Audiveris中的书籍与乐谱结构关系图,展示多页乐谱的组织方式,多页乐谱批量处理的基础概念

💡实用提示:修正错误时优先处理关键音乐元素(如音符、节拍),再处理装饰性符号。使用快捷键提高修正效率,如F2编辑选中元素,Ctrl+Z撤销操作。

工具获取与进阶学习

获取Audiveris

git clone https://gitcode.com/gh_mirrors/au/audiveris

参数配置模板

项目提供了多种预设参数模板,位于app/config-examples/目录下,可根据需要导入使用。

进阶学习路径

初学者

  • 官方用户手册:docs/handbook.md
  • 快速入门教程:docs/tutorials/quick/

进阶用户

  • 高级配置指南:docs/guides/advanced/
  • 自定义符号训练:docs/guides/advanced/training.md
  • 插件开发文档:docs/guides/advanced/plugins.md

通过以上步骤,您已经掌握了使用Audiveris进行乐谱数字化的核心技巧。从高质量图像采集到参数优化配置,再到高效错误修正,这套流程将帮助您快速将纸质乐谱转换为可编辑的数字格式。无论是个人音乐收藏整理还是专业音乐出版工作,Audiveris都能成为您的得力助手,让乐谱数字化变得简单高效。🎵

【免费下载链接】audiverisaudiveris - 一个开源的光学音乐识别(OMR)应用程序,用于将乐谱图像转录为其符号对应物,支持多种数字处理方式。项目地址: https://gitcode.com/gh_mirrors/au/audiveris

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/3 6:28:20

电商平台智能客服系统接入实战:从零搭建到生产环境部署

电商平台智能客服系统接入实战:从零搭建到生产环境部署 摘要:本文针对开发者在接入电商平台智能客服系统时面临的API对接复杂、消息队列处理效率低、会话状态管理困难等痛点,提供了一套完整的解决方案。通过对比主流技术方案,详细…

作者头像 李华
网站建设 2026/4/8 12:10:11

戴森球计划蓝图库效率攻略:从零开始打造完美工厂

戴森球计划蓝图库效率攻略:从零开始打造完美工厂 【免费下载链接】FactoryBluePrints 游戏戴森球计划的**工厂**蓝图仓库 项目地址: https://gitcode.com/GitHub_Trending/fa/FactoryBluePrints 还在为戴森球计划中混乱的生产线而头疼吗?FactoryB…

作者头像 李华
网站建设 2026/4/18 7:42:59

ChatGPT手机版安装包实战:从下载到集成的全流程避坑指南

背景痛点:移动端集成 ChatGPT 的三座大山 下载阶段:官方安装包(APK/IPA)仅面向北美区 App Store/Google Play,国内开发者需频繁切换账号或依赖镜像站,极易触发行级风控导致账号封禁。SDK 集成:…

作者头像 李华
网站建设 2026/4/18 8:02:02

如何让尘封的Flash文件重获新生?Ruffle模拟器的5个实战方案

如何让尘封的Flash文件重获新生?Ruffle模拟器的5个实战方案 【免费下载链接】ruffle A Flash Player emulator written in Rust 项目地址: https://gitcode.com/GitHub_Trending/ru/ruffle 你是否曾在整理旧硬盘时,发现那些承载着青春记忆的SWF游…

作者头像 李华